Subterranean termites are widely thought about the most harmful financial pests in the area. Unlike other household pests that leave apparent signs of their presence, termites operate totally in the dark, chewing through the structural core of a home while leaving the outer veneer totally intact. A home can harbor a huge, active nest for many years without the owners seeing a single external sign of problem. By the time noticeable symptoms finally appear, such as drooping floorboards, jammed doors, fractured plasterboard, or mysterious blistering on painted timber skirtings, the structural stability of the building may already be severely compromised, causing tens of thousands of dollars in emergency situation repair work.

Modern technology plays a significant function in elevating the accuracy of these evaluations. Trusted experts do not count on visual checks alone, they utilize advanced diagnostic tools to find surprise activity deep behind finished walls. Wetness meters help determine locations of high humidity within wall cavities, which Termite Inspections Rivett often indicates a focused termite gallery. Thermal imaging electronic cameras find the subtle heat signatures created by large clusters of termites collaborating. Additionally, specialized movement detection devices can pick up the faint vibrations of termites chewing inside structural timbers, permitting service technicians to map out the exact scope of an infestation without harming the home linings.
Getting an in-depth written report following the assessment supplies homeowner with vital assistance. This document describes any current activity, determines specific high threat locations, and highlights favorable conditions that may attract pests in the future, such as dripping garden taps, poor subfloor ventilation, or wood mulch piled directly versus the external brickwork. Addressing these environmental elements immediately reduces the likelihood of a future attack. Based upon the findings, the expert will also advise a suitable long term management method, which might consist of the setup of chemical soil barriers or monitored baiting systems to intercept foraging colonies before they ever reach the building structure.
